What You'll Be Contributing:
Reporting directly to the Divisional Director of Finance, this role provides analytical, reporting, and operational support across the business unit.

Financial Responsibilities

  • Assist the Divisional Director of Finance in the preparation of budgets and forecasts, including updating monthly rolling forecasts and supporting data collection.
  • Perform reconciliations and variance analysis to support management reporting.
  • Support month-end close for assigned functional areas
  • Maintain and update financial models under the guidance of the Divisional Director of Finance.
  • Contribute to the preparation of management presentations and financial reporting packages.
  • Support profitability and margin analysis at product, customer, or business-unit levels.
  • Assist in implementing financial process improvements and BI/reporting tools.

Operational Responsibilities

  • Partner with the Divisional Director of Finance and operations teams (sales, production, logistics, etc.) to gather data for KPIs and performance tracking.
  • Extract, transform, and validate data from multiple systems to support decision-making.
  • Prepare and maintain dashboards and reports for use by operations and leadership teams.
  • Contribute to ad hoc analyses and projects assigned by the Divisional Director of Finance.
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ives by documenting processes and identifying areas for streamlining.
  • Participate in cross-training with Finance team members to ensure continuity of operations.

What Sets You Apart:
The ideal candidate will be detail-oriented, technically strong in data handling and reporting, and eager to grow in FP&A by contributing to budgeting, forecasting, month-end activities, and operational support initiatives.

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field.
  • 1–3 years of experience in financial analysis, reporting, or a related field.
  • Strong Excel and PowerPoint skills; Power BI or similar tools an asset.
  • Experience with ERP systems (SAP Business One, or equivalent preferred).
  •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and ability to work with large data sets.
  • Ability to prioritize mult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ment.
  • Team player with str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• A proactive, resourceful approach with a willingness to learn and take on new challenges.

About Hypertec
Founded in 1984, Hypertec empowers innovators to push boundaries and lead their industries through transformative technology.

Through our five divisions—High Performance Compute & AI, Data Center Construction, Health, Custom Manufacturing, and Solutions Partner—we help clients turn complex challenges into opportunities for sustainable growth. Trusted by leaders in AI, financial services, media & entertainment, healthcare, and the public sector, we serve clients in over 80 countries.

Recognized globally for innovation and sustainability, including our revolutionary immersion-born servers, we continue to deliver technology that makes a lasting difference.
